A lot of third-party backup vendors will tell you the same reasons for why you need to backup Microsoft 365.

It’s one thing to hear the theory from the vendor, its another entirely to hear the real world value from those who are directly responsible for protecting their organizations data or the managed service providers responsible for protecting their customer’s data.

We’ll take you through quick vignettes covering how organizations have built backup strategies that:

  • Enhanced SLAs to enable 24/7 restore support at the item level
  • Overcame regulatory hurdles to Microsoft Teams and supported sustainable adoption
  • Brushed off a successful ransomware attack against a company executive
  • Aligned to GDPR regulations by deciding where backup data would live and how to comply with right to be forgotten requests so you don’t accidentally restore it back into production
  • Covered advanced workloads in Teams and Planner
  • Saved more than 8 hours a month maintaining backups and reduced costs
  • Protected metadata and permission settings
